How Kleanland Electrostatic Precipitators support cut down Airborne Particles in Textile Manufacturing

The textile dyeing and finishing method generates substantial amounts of oil-bearing fumes and natural and organic compounds, like textile auxiliaries. These fumes can achieve densities of around 80mg/m3, posing really serious well being risks to employees and contributing to air air pollution. Kleanland esp hire Highly developed electrostatic precipitation engineering to capture and remove these airborne particles successfully. By creating an electrostatic charge, the ESP draws in and collects even the smallest particles, making certain the air released from textile factories is noticeably cleaner. This not only helps guard the surroundings but also makes a safer Performing natural environment for workers.

Why Electrostatic Precipitators Are Essential for managing Emissions in Textile Processing Plants

Electrostatic precipitators, particularly those intended by Kleanland, are essential for controlling emissions in textile processing plants. These crops frequently deal with several different pollutants, together with organic and natural oils, dyes, dye auxiliaries, lubricant oils, and fiber particles. Traditional air filtration systems struggle to control this sort of a diverse range of contaminants efficiently. However, the Innovative ESP know-how utilized by Kleanland captures these pollutants with significant efficiency. by utilizing a mix of water scrubbers, dual-generate extensive spacing esp, and oil and water separators, Kleanland esp make certain that exhaust gases are addressed comprehensively before getting produced to the atmosphere. This thorough approach tends to make them an important part in contemporary textile production services, encouraging corporations adjust to stringent environmental regulations.
